Управление видимостью данных в Excel через группировку
Группировка ячеек в Excel позволяет скрывать и отображать строки или столбцы одним кликом, создавая многоуровневую структуру отчета без удаления данных. Чтобы сгруппировать выбранные строки или столбцы, выделите их, перейдите на вкладку «Данные» и нажмите кнопку «Группировать» (или используйте горячие клавиши Shift + Alt + →). Это создаст панель с кнопками «плюс» и «минус» для быстрого сворачивания деталей.
Зачем это нужно? Группировка идеальна для больших отчетов: она позволяет руководству видеть только итоги, а исполнителям — при необходимости раскрывать детализацию по периодам, отделам или статьям расходов.
Основные способы группировки
В Excel существует два основных типа ручной группировки и один автоматический (в сводных таблицах). Выбор зависит от структуры ваших данных.
Ручная группировка строк и столбцов
Используется для обычных диапазонов данных, где нужно логически объединить смежные строки или столбцы.
- Выделение: Выберите строки (кликните по номерам слева) или столбцы (кликните по буквам сверху), которые хотите объединить в группу.
- Важно: Выделять нужно именно заголовки строк/столбцов, а не просто ячейки внутри них.
- Команда: На вкладке «Данные» в группе «Структура» нажмите «Группировать».
- Результат: Слева (для строк) или сверху (для столбцов) появится серая линия со знаком «минус». Нажатие на него скроет содержимое группы.
Горячие клавиши для скорости Запомните две комбинации, чтобы работать быстрее мыши:
- Сгруппировать:
Shift+Alt+Стрелка вправо - Разгруппировать:
Shift+Alt+Стрелка влево
Многоуровневая вложенность
Вы можете создавать группы внутри других групп. Например, сгруппировать дни в недели, а недели — в месяцы.
- Сначала создайте мелкие группы (например, по неделям).
- Затем выделите полученные блоки и сгруппируйте их еще раз (по месяцам).
- Слева появятся цифры
1,2,3, позволяющие переключаться между уровнями детализации одним кликом.
Автоматическая группировка в сводных таблицах
Если вы работаете со сводной таблицей (Pivot Table), ручная группировка часто не требуется — Excel умеет делать это автоматически, особенно с датами и числами.
Как сгруппировать даты:
- Кликните правой кнопкой мыши по любой дате в строках сводной таблицы.
- Выберите пункт «Группировать».
- В окне выберите шаг: «Месяцы», «Кварталы», «Годы». Можно выбрать несколько вариантов одновременно (например, Годы и Месяцы).
Как сгруппировать числа: Аналогично датам, числовые значения можно объединить в диапазоны (например, продажи от 0 до 1000, от 1001 до 5000).
- ПКМ по числу в сводной таблице → «Группировать».
- Укажите начальное значение, конечное и шаг интервала.
Частая ошибка с датами Если команда «Группировать» для дат неактивна или выдает ошибку, проверьте исходный диапазон. Часто причина в том, что одна или несколько ячеек с датами записаны как текст или содержат ошибку. Исправьте формат ячеек на «Дата», чтобы функция сработала.
Практические примеры использования
| Задача | Тип группировки | Результат |
|---|---|---|
| Финансовый отчет | Ручная (строки) | Статьи расходов сгруппированы по категориям (ФОТ, Аренда, Маркетинг). Итог по категории виден всегда, детали скрыты. |
| Анализ продаж за год | Сводная таблица (даты) | Ежедневные продажи автоматически собраны в месяцы и кварталы. Легко сравнить сезоны. |
| Широкая таблица характеристик | Ручная (столбцы) | Второстепенные параметры (артикул, цвет, вес) скрыты в группы, на экране остаются только ключевые метрики. |
Как убрать группировку
Если структура больше не нужна или была создана ошибочно:
- Выделите сгруппированные строки или столбцы (или всю таблицу, нажав
Ctrl+A). - Перейдите на вкладку «Данные» → «Разгруппировать».
- Либо используйте горячие клавиши
Shift+Alt+Стрелка влево.
Чтобы удалить все уровни группировки на листе сразу:
- Вкладка «Данные» → кнопка «Удалить структуру» (находится рядом с кнопкой «Группировать»).
Частые ошибки и проблемы
- Кнопка «Группировать» неактивна.
Убедитесь, что вы выделили целые строки или столбцы, а не разрозненные ячейки. Также функция не работает, если лист защищен паролем или данные находятся внутри официальной «Умной таблицы» (форматировано как таблица) — в этом случае сначала преобразуйте таблицу в диапазон (
ПКМ→Таблица→Преобразовать в диапазон). - Скрылись не те данные. При создании группы Excel включает все строки между первой и последней выделенной. Если у вас есть пустые строки-разделители внутри выделения, они тоже попадут в группу. Удаляйте лишние пустоты перед группировкой.
- Невозможно сгруппировать даты в сводной.
Как упоминалось выше, проверьте тип данных. Иногда даты импортируются из 1С или других систем в текстовом формате. Используйте функцию
ДАТАЗНАЧили «Текст по столбцам», чтобы привести их к нужному виду.
FAQ
Можно ли группировать несмежные строки? Нет, стандартная функция группировки работает только с непрерывными диапазонами. Для работы с разрозненными данными лучше использовать фильтры или сводные таблицы.
Сохраняется ли группировка при отправке файла? Да, получатель файла увидит все созданные вами уровни и сможет сворачивать/разворачивать их, если у него есть доступ к редактированию структуры (лист не защищен).
Влияет ли группировка на формулы? Нет. Скрытие строк через группировку не удаляет данные. Все формулы, ссылающиеся на скрытые ячейки, продолжают работать корректно и учитывать эти значения в расчетах.
Как скрыть знаки «плюс» и «минус» на экране?
Если вам нужно распечатать отчет без символов структуры: перейдите в Файл → Параметры → Дополнительно → раздел «Параметры отображения для этого листа» и снимите галочку «Отображать символы структуры».